Pirate boys soccer upset by Falcons
By Cort Reynolds
The Bluffton High School boys soccer team fell victim to a second-half rally and was defeated 2-1 at Riverdale Saturday, September 30, in a non-league match at Falcon Field.
The Pirates led 1-0 at the half, but gave up two goals after intermission to lose.
Bluffton dropped to 4-7-2 overall with the road defeat.
The Riverdale record improved to 2-10-1 with their second win in the last three outings.
Pirate Theo Andreas netted the lone Bluffton goal for the second straight game to give the visitors a 1-0 lead.
Will Clark tallied the Falcon goal directly on a free kick from 25 yards out to tie it 1-1 with just over 14 minutes remaining.
Cody Flowers-Barger then re-directed a missed Gage Miller shot into the back of the net to provide the difference.
Bluffton earned three corner kicks to five by Riverdale. The Pirates put three shots on goal, while the Falcons directed seven shots on target.
Keeper Truett Diller made five saves for Bluffton.
The league-leading Pirates (3-0 Northwest Conference) host second-place foe Lincolnview (6-4-2, 2-0-1 NWC) Monday, October 2 in a key conference match.
A win would put the Pirates in the driver’s seat for a ninth straight NWC crown.
